The Mille Miglia returns to Este: a spectacle of history and engines on June 10.
Este welcomes the passage of the Mille Miglia, the famous historical car competition taking place from June 9 to 13. During the second stage, from Padua to Montecatini Terme, over 400 vintage cars will cross the territory of Este, offering citizens and visitors a unique show of elegance, tradition, and passion for motors.
After the editions of 2014 and 2017, the “Red Arrow” returns to Este with a timed special test included in the official route of the race. The cars will depart from Padua at 6:30 a.m. and, passing through Montegrotto Terme, Lozzo Atestino, and the picturesque landscapes of the Euganean Hills, will reach the city approximately at 7:10 a.m.
The convoy will enter from via Caldevigo to then cross some of the main city arteries, touching the historic center before proceeding along the SR10 towards Deserto. The timed test will take place on via Principe Umberto, in the section between Piazza Maggiore and parking P1, which will remain accessible.
